More than 13 thousand people attended the first day of the Antonov Apples Festival in Kolomna

The X International Apple-Book Festival “Antonov Apples” started in Kolomna on September 3. On the first day it was visited by more than 13 thousand people.

For the guests of the festival, 15 venues were set up in the historical center of the city, where musical and theatrical performances, master classes and art installations were prepared.

Conversations about memoirs, memoirs and diaries were held in the open Literary Studio. Children’s writer Anastasia Strokina told about a journey with ghosts in the Victorian era. The visitors also managed to talk with the author of the novel “The Garden” Maria Stepnova.

Lyudmila Zhumaeva’s living room was responsible for the musical part of the festival together with the Helikon Opera with the program “I remember the waltz sound charming” (musical theater “Ge”), Imperialis Orchestra and saxophonist Konstantin Safyanov and others.

The festival guests were shown performances of the Moscow Regional State Academic Ballet Theater “Russian Ballet”, the Mytishchi Drama and Comedy Theater “FEST” and the Melikhovsky Theater “Chekhov Studio”.

New products from more than 30 publishers, including children’s ones, were presented at the book market. Visitors were invited to a traditional city lunch in the courtyard of the Artkommunalka Museum.

At the end of the first day of the festival, a plane from the Aerograd club flew over the Moscow River.

The organizers of the “Antonovsky Apples” were the Ministry of Culture of the Moscow region, the Russian Cultural Foundation, the Center for Educational Tourism “Kolomenskiy Posad”, the GAUC MO “Center for Cultural Initiatives”.

On the second day, the festival program was continued at the Dostoevsky museum-estate “Darovoe”.
